The modern LGBTQ+ rights movement owes a great debt to transgender pioneers. Historically, trans women of color were the "backbone" of the movement, leading landmark protests like those at the Stonewall Inn in 1969. Leaders like Stormé DeLarverie dedicated their lives to protecting queer spaces, paving the way for contemporary victories in job protection and equality.
